Departure and Raritan Bay**After departing Middletown Township, head toward the Navesink River. Follow it downstream until you reach the confluence with the Shrewsbury River. Continue outbound towards Raritan Bay, where you can enjoy the picturesque coastline and watch as local fishermen ply their trade.* **Points of Interest:** - Sandy Hook National Park offers stunning views and historical sites—perfect for a quick excursion. - The bay has several fishing opportunities if you wish to drop a line.**2. Navigational Aids and Hazards**As you proceed into Raritan Bay, keep an eye out for navigational buoys marking the shipping channels. Pay particular attention to: - The Sandy Hook Light (Fl. 15s 90ft 4M) standing sentinel at the entrance to the bay, an important visual reference. - Remember that this area can have strong currents, especially with tidal changes, so plan your cruise accordingly.#### Shelter Options:**Key Shelters:** - **Sandy Hook Bay** is your first notable shelter. It offers refuge in case the weather turns unfavorable. - **Anchorage at Great Kills Park** provides a safe harbor with beautiful natural surroundings.#### 3. Heading Toward the Upper New York BayContinue north past the Raritan Bay and approach the entrance to the Upper New York Bay. The views of the Manhattan skyline from this part of the journey are breathtaking. * **Navigational Considerations:** - Watch for the Staten Island Ferry traffic in this area; they are large and can create wakes, which may affect your handling. - Be aware of the local speed regulations as you enter areas with heavy traffic. The Hudson River is known for both its commercial shipping lanes and recreational traffic.#### Notable Landmarks: - As you cruise past the Statue of Liberty, consider a quick stop at Liberty State Park for some sightseeing. - The Ellis Island can also be a fascinating detour for those interested in history.**4. Approach to New York Harbor**Upon entering New York Harbor, keep an eye on the busy ferry routes. Ensure your position is constant via GPS or visual markers. Use local charts to navigate around the various piers and exits around this bustling area.#### Arrival Point: New York, NYAs you draw closer to your destination, the vibrant marina scene of New York, NY, welcomes you.
